OverviewDiversity, Equity, Inclusion, and Anti-Racism work is not easy! Increase engagement and retention of concepts by reducing frustration, harm, and failure. If you are a leader in an organization and want to create a culture of trust around DEI, I hope you find key takeaways from the work I have done with teams. It will be ordered in for you and dispatched immediately.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ationKathleen Johnson is a DEI and Anti-Racism educator, consultant, and coach. She is CEO of Kreativ Culture Strategies, which helps organizations creatively experience culture shift, and is a senior consultant at Provincial Health Services Authority in British Columbia, Canada. Kathleen holds a bachelor's degree in Sociology and Cultural Anthropology from Carleton University, a paralegal diploma from Canadian Business College, and a DEI certificate from Cornell University. She was in the arts for many years as a makeup artist in film and television. In the middle of her career in the arts she was diagnosed with breast cancer and has been in remission for 10 years. Today she resides on Vancouver Island and has 5 adult children with special needs, including autism.
